How long does it take to build a application?
Our projects generally take between 6-12 weeks. First is the design process, which takes 3 - 4 weeks, then we start development which varies widely based on your project.

How many people will work on my project?
Your project will have somewhere between 3-5 people working on it full time until it is complete. A project manager will guide you through all phases of the project, a designer will create the user experience, a team lead will manage the technical work, and awesome developers will code it.

What is an MVP and why it's so important?
An MVP (minimum viable product) helps you ship just enough code to test your assumptions, but not too little code that your users won’t love your app. It helps you learn quickly and inexpensively what users need so you save time and money.
